Not long after we arrived, we started to prepare the food; my mother-in-law prepared the tabirak, and my wife helped her by grating the coconuts. Tabirak is also called binignit in our locality; it is made by boiling sticky rice and adding sweet potatoes, tapioca pearl, taro, landang, ube, jackfruit and coconut milk and is sweetened by brown sugar.

IMG_20250418_134322.jpg

This is how the binignit looks like; to add more touch of the coconut, my sister in law and my wife agreed to put the binignit on the coconut shell and topped it with ube halaya. The result was stunning!
